Concrete pavement demolition services involve the careful removal of existing concrete surfaces, such as driveways, walkways, parking lots, or industrial flooring.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ment and techniques to break up and eliminate old or damaged concrete efficiently and safely. This process often includes preparing the site, breaking down the concrete into manageable pieces, and removing debris to create a clean, level foundation for new paving or other construction projects. Proper demolition ensures that the underlying surface is ready for the next phase of construction or renovation, helping to achieve a smooth and durable result.
These services are essential for addressing a variety of common problems with existing concrete surfaces. Cracks, spalling, or unevenness can compromise the safety and appearance of a pavement, making it necessary to remove and replace the damaged sections. In addition, old concrete may no longer meet current load requirements or aesthetic standards, prompting property owners to opt for demolition and new installation. Removing deteriorated concrete can also help prevent further issues like water infiltration or structural instability, protecting the integrity of the property.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Pavement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kenner, LA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or concrete pavement demolition projects in Kenner, LA range from $250 to $600. These jobs usually involve removing small sections or patches and are common for routine maintenance or repairs. Most projects fall within this middle range, with fewer reaching the higher end.
Medium-Scale Projects - Demolishing larger pavement areas, such as driveways or parking lot sections, gener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Local contractors often handle these jobs regularly, which tend to stay within this moderate cost band depending on size and complexity.
Large or Complex Demolition - Larger projects, including extensive lot removals or demolition of multiple pavement sections, can range from $3,500 to $8,000 or more. These jobs are less frequent and typically involve more labor, equipment, and planning, pushing costs into the higher tiers.
Full Replacement or Major Projects - Complete pavement removal and replacement in Kenner can exceed $10,000, especially for large commercial sites or heavily reinforced concrete. Such projects are less common and represent the upper end of typical cost ranges for extensive demolition efforts.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in concrete pavement demolition? Local contractors typically use specialized equipment to break up and remove existing concrete pavement, preparing the area for new construction or repairs.
Are there different methods for demolishing concrete pavement? Yes, methods can include mechanical breaking, jackhammering, or saw-cutting, depending on the project scope and site conditions.
What types of concrete pavement can local service providers handle? They can manage various types, including driveways, parking lots, sidewalks, and large slabs used in commercial or industrial settings.
Is it necessary to obtain permits for concrete pavement demolition? Permit requirements vary by location; local contractors can advise on whether permits are needed for specific projects in Kenner, LA.
How do local contractors ensure the safe disposal of demolished concrete? They follow proper disposal procedures, transporting debris to approved facilities in accordance with local regulations.
